Why Stone Powder Matters in Tehran's Solar Industry
Tehran's photovoltaic glass manufacturers are increasingly adopting specialized stone powder to enhance solar panel performance. With Iran's solar capacity growing at 23% annually (2020-2024), material innovation becomes crucial for meeting both domestic needs and export demands.
Key Advantages for Solar Applications
- Enhanced Durability: Resists micro-cracking in Tehran's extreme temperature variations (-5°C to 45°C)
- Cost Efficiency: Reduces raw material costs by 18-22% compared to imported alternatives
- Environmental Compliance: Meets Iran's ISIRI 12345 standards for eco-friendly manufacturing

Choosing the Right Supplier: 5 Critical Factors
- Particle size consistency (D50 ≤ 15μm)
- Iron content below 0.08%
- On-site technical support availability
- Customizable packaging solutions
- ISO 9001-certified production facilities
